Grain-Free and Limited-Ingredient Diets: Options for Dogs with Food Sensitivities
Dogs with food sensitivities require special attention and care. Open Farm’s grain-free and limited-ingredient diets are designed to accommodate these pets, providing a range of options that cater to their unique needs. The company’s grain-free recipes are made with high-quality protein sources and whole vegetables, while its limited-ingredient diets feature a single protein source and a small number of other ingredients. This approach allows pet owners to identify and manage their dog’s food sensitivities, reducing the risk of adverse reactions and promoting overall health and well-being.

Customer Satisfaction Guarantee: A Commitment to Pet Owners
Open Farm’s customer satisfaction guarantee is a testament to the company’s commitment to pet owners. If a pet owner is not satisfied with their Open Farm product, the company offers a full refund or exchange. This guarantee provides peace of mind for pet owners who trust Open Farm to provide the best for their pets. By standing behind its products, Open Farm demonstrates its confidence in the quality and safety of its ingredients and manufacturing process.
